
Lasagna Roll Ups Recipe – Delicious lasagna rolls made with Italian sausage, ricotta cheese and spinach rolled up and topped with meat sauce, mozzarella and parmesan cheese. You are going to love this mouthwatering twist on the classic lasagna!
Lasagna Rolls are the perfect easy kid friendly dinner recipe! Not only are they super easy to make but they are melt in your mouth delicious. This recipe makes 12 rolls feeding about 6 people and makes for amazing leftovers!
If you are cooking for a larger crowd, you can easy double the recipe. If you are cooking for a smaller crowd, simply cut the recipe in half and use an 8×8 baking dish.
Store completely cooled leftover lasagna rolls in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 2-3 days. You can also freeze lasagna in an airtight freezer bag for up to a month.
